MStar Semiconductor (now part of MediaTek) produces system-on-chip (SoC) solutions widely used in smart TVs, set-top boxes, digital signage, and low-cost Android TV boxes. Their firmware binaries — often packaged as .bin files — contain bootloaders, kernel images, root filesystems, and device-specific configurations.
